  1. The song is about a married couple who find that the "fire" has gone out of their relationship. It relates the desire of both partners to travel to "Jackson" where the husband believes he will be turned loose, be with many women and be practically worshipped as he has his wild time.

  6. Jul 13, 2024 · Johnny Cash and June Carter Cash’s duet, “Jackson,” is a timeless country classic that tells the story of a married couple whose relationship has lost its spark. Released in 1967, the song reached number two on the Billboard Country Singles chart and has since become one of Cash’s most beloved hits.
